Biographical overview
William Henry Gates III grew up in Seattle, showed early aptitude for computers, and dropped out of Harvard in 1975 to co-found Microsoft. He led Microsoft as CEO, then shifted to chairman and later to a full-time role at the Gates Foundation after 2000. In recent years he has returned to part-time work at Microsoft and devoted significant time to global health, climate, and education initiatives through his foundation. Philanthropy and public impact
Through the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Gates has shaped global conversations on vaccines, polio eradication, malaria, agricultural development, and climate innovation. His approach combines rigorous data, pilot programs, and partnerships with governments and NGOs.
